Production Process

The production process starts with a Production Order.

8|Page

Production Order

In production order the list of the type of the product is to be manufactured is listed that is
the code of the product followed by art number, size, color and quantity.

9|Page

Job Card

It is created after Product Order is received.


It consists of details regarding which process is to be done by whom.

10 | P a g e

Production Report

It generate all the report that are related to the production department i.e. how much order
is completed by each employee that is process wise and how much process is pending.
It also generated workers pay roll details according to amount of work done by each
employee.

11 | P a g e

Inventory Management

Store issue and receipt consist of the information about how much stock is bought from the
fabricator and how much stock is available in the companys store house. It also includes
details about the amount of fabric issued to the employee for the production.

Use of the Information System

The system is being used primarily for two major purposes Manufacturing,
accounting and inventory management.
The input into the system is generally done by the manager. Input is generally of
purchase/sale information of various products or about the information of internal
recipients of various items.
The output of the system is used by both middle and upper level management in
order to take right decisions for the organization.
This software helps the top management in decision making by giving a
comprehensive picture with analytical reports which give them correct information
about various departments.
o For manufacturing department it helps them understanding which products
production is to take place, how much fabric is needed for its activities and
when the product is to be dispatched to the buyer.
o For the accounting department it helps them understanding the flow of the
working capital and total expenditure on incoming material and the revenues
being generated by the outgoing finished product,
It also eases calculation of workers payroll.
o For inventory management, it helps them in understanding the demands of
the various departments for various consumable items and the fabric needs,
the frequency of their usage, when to order the next lot and the overall
managements of the stocks.

Step 5: Developing a Business Case


Benefits to the Clients
improved response time to customer requests for information
delivered product meets customer requirements
immediate access to order status
greater extent of solution options

Generating more revenues by:


Conversion of more leads- acceleration of revenue by accelerating the early
parts of the buying process to do with identifying needs, potential solutions
and benefits- gaining new customers
More cross-selling and up-selling
Higher levels of customer satisfaction and retention- holding onto customers
for longer
More sales from more effective selling processes

Reducing costs by:


Enhanced lead generation
Low costs - customer acquisition
Reduced customer service costs
